From the "Portland Daily Press," ME, May 7, 1897, p. 9,

There was a pleasant wedding at 77 Winter street, in this city, Wednesday evening, when Mr. Frank L. Beals and Miss Mabel Bridgham, popular young people of Auburn, were made one. The bride is a niece of Mr. H. B. Shurtleff, at whose home the marriage took place. Rev. F. C. Rogers, of the Pine street church, officiated, making use of the beautiful Episcopal marriage service. Immediate friends of the bride and groom from Auburn were present. Mr. Beals is in trade in Auburn and the wedded pair will reside in that city.
